Core Scientific, Inc. by the numbers
Core Scientific, Inc. (CORZ) reported revenue of $164M in Q2 2026 (quarter ended June 30, 2026), up 109% from the same quarter a year earlier. That came with a gross margin of 43% and net loss of $1.16B. For the full year FY2025, revenue was $319M (−38% year on year) and net income −$289M. Its largest product in 2026-Q1 was Colocation Service at $78M, 67% of the disclosed total, just ahead of Digital Asset Self Mining Service at 26%.
| Income statement | Q2 2026 | Q2 2025 | Change |
|---|---|---|---|
| Revenue | $164M | $79M | +109% |
| Gross profit | $70M | $5.0M | +1294% |
| Operating income | −$78M | −$26M | n/a |
| Net income | −$1.16B | −$937M | n/a |
| Diluted EPS | −$3.32 | −$0.04 | n/a |
| Product | Revenue | Share |
|---|---|---|
| Colocation Service | $78M | 67% |
| Digital Asset Self Mining Service | $30M | 26% |
| Digital Asset Hosted Mining Service | $7.6M | 6.6% |
